Volleyball Falls in Four at Saint Louis

Rams Take Set One But Fall in Three Straight Thereafter

Box Score (pdf)

Saint Louis, Mo. – The Fordham volleyball team grabbed set one in a crucial Atlantic 10 match-up at Saint Louis on Friday night but the hosts rallied back for three straight games to take the match in four. With the result, the Rams fall under .500 for the first time this season, moving to 12-13 overall and 4-8 in conference action. The Bilikens improve to 10-14 and 7-4, respectively.
 
Fordham rallied in the first set, overturning a lead the hosts had held for much of the frame, beginning at 20-17. Molly Oshinski began with a kill and got in on a block on the next play alongside fellow senior Nicole Freeley to get within one. After a Saint Louis timeout, the Rams retook the lead after consecutive Maya Taylor attack errors. Sien Gallop tied things up with a kill but Fordham fired off four straight points to take the set. Olivia Fairchild, the nation's leader in service aces, followed a kill with three straight aces.
 
The Bilikens bounced back in set two, racking up 17 kills at a .432 clip, as the Rams notched 10 on .167 hitting, and again with 13 kills at a .345 pace in set three compared to Fordham's seven.
 
Gallop paced the match with 21 kills, while Fairchild led the way for the Rams with 13, also notching all four of Fordham's aces, giving her a career-high 60 on the year, which is the sixth-most in a single-season. She also hops over Kailee May ('10) into sixth all-time overall, with 117. Next is Mele Misi ('03) with 129.
 
Oshinski finished with a season-high eight kills, while McKenna Lahr, who also had eight kills, set a new personal-best with 18 digs. Maddy Walsh double-doubled with 24 assists and 11 digs, while Morgan Williams notched 10.
 
Fordham travels to Dayton on Sunday afternoon, playing at 1 p.m., and finishes the regular season at Rhode Island next Friday night.
